Overview30 international artists and collectives explore the fundamentals of human coexistence. The focus is on land management. Land connects: we cultivate and manage it, we share feelings for our homeland. Land divides: some have it, others do not. Land ownership has been and remains a decisive factor of power in all social systems. How can housing remain affordable? How can the Amazon be preserved as the green lung of the planet? And how can cooperation across borders and differences become a source of joy again? The exhibition “Land and Soil” invites visitors to understand their own place in the history of the global economy and to design a just future. The publication introduces the artists and brings the world of soil to life.
